    Frequently Asked Questions

    How do I remove page numbers from the normal view in Excel?

    Click on View, then click Normal under the Workbook View group to remove the page number watermark.

    How do I delete page numbers from the header or footer in Excel?

    Select your worksheets, click the Page Layout tab, click the Dialog Box Launcher next to Page Setup, then in the Header/Footer tab select (none) from the Header or Footer drop-down box.
